Book Review: "Deep Into The Dark" By P.J. Tracy



An interesting police procedural storyline that focuses on one man with PTSD, his wife, and an abused woman fleeing for her life.

What could be worse than this except the fact that Sam is now the murder suspect in regards to being the last person to see Melody's boyfriend alive.
YIKES!

This coupled with the fact that we now have several chilling murders on our hands and you can imagine all hell breaks loose.

Who is this mystery person in the black jeep?
What about this guy named Rolf Hesse?

What does this black jeep, this one particular guy, Katy Villa, Consuela and others have in common with these Miracle Mile Killings and Sam?

Will Sam ever see justice served? Will Melody live to tell her story?
Will their be peace in the valley?

A good solid three pointer for me by the wonderfully talented P.J. Tracy.
